Marketing & Communications has never been easy, but today there are all new curveballs coming at you daily. In this episode of the Tony award winning hit “May the Best Brand Win” we’re going to talk about confusion and how it screws things up. Specifically, we’re gonna hit a few confusing topics like the recent FTC guidelines for influencer marketing, outside interference in our largest social networks by foreign interests and hyper-political comms aimed at boycotting and praising brands.  And somehow, we will make some sense out of this mess in 60 minutes or less. We’ll also hit who’s winning and losing this week in Marketing & Communications as always so join me for what is sure to be yet another episode of May the Best Brand Win.
